About tert-butyl N-[(4-formyl-2-pyridinyl)methyl]-N-[2-oxo-2-[(2R)-2-(pyrrolidin-1-ylmethyl)pyrrolidin-1-yl]ethyl]carbamate

tert-butyl N-[(4-formyl-2-pyridinyl)methyl]-N-[2-oxo-2-[(2R)-2-(pyrrolidin-1-ylmethyl)pyrrolidin-1-yl]ethyl]carbamate (PubChem CID 90375150) has the molecular formula C23H34N4O4 and a molecular weight of 430.55 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is tert-butyl N-[(4-formyl-2-pyridinyl)methyl]-N-[2-oxo-2-[(2R)-2-(pyrrolidin-1-ylmethyl)pyrrolidin-1-yl]ethyl]carbamate.
